I am not sure when they ran that challenge but in the last 8 months they have resurfaced part of the track, adjusted the chicane ( straighter ) and added a new section by the skidpad. SOW is always in a state of flux to keep it fresh and fun to run. Once again, the BIG course is the standard by which cars in this area are tested.

I got a request to clarify which person / shop did the work on the car, I have been careful up to now to not paint with a broad brush so here goes:
Last year in the October time frame I visited Don Hollingshead in NJ and discuss with him what I wanted to do with my car, my original intensions were to get the parts from him and have Charlie (my brother an Audi master mechanic) do the work, I also asked for a quote to do the work.
Well I got impatient and had Don do the project in January 07 he kept the car for a week to do the head, re-ring and rod bearings, clutch, flywheel, and Quaife. All the work was done by Don himself not the folks that work in the shop, so my impressions are of the quality work than Don does not the folks in the shop, 400 miles after I got my car back the engine blew apart on the LIE in rush hour traffic, I was still in the breaking process at the time, turns out that the number 2 con rod bolts were either over torqued or not torqued worked its self loose and then snapped which caused the con rod to break and straight through the side of the block.
Don's first response to me after I called him was that the car had lots of miles so it must have been an hair line fracture and not his fault, then he proceeded to tell me how I could get a block / engine for 2.5K and he would repair it, mind you he did not say that he would do it as warranty he wanted to charge me again to correct his mistake, I think not I may be stupid but I am no fool, I had Habbetstad get a new engine and had the repair completed for $8K so now my project just cost me $18K and I still have a standard JCW.
